A good idea, with poor implementation (Updated)
The upgrades to this model were not adequate to fix the overall reliability issues with the faucet. You'll note that most reviews are from relatively new owners of this faucet. This is my second, and both have mechanically failed rather quickly (the first in 18 months, the second in 9 months).Delta made several improvements to this version of the faucet. A waterproof battery compartment and nylon hose to replace the previous metal hose. But the magnetic ring that holds the spray head in place is simply a plastic-wrapped magnet. It rusts out, swells, and causes the spray head to sit at a canted angle (very noticeable) and eventually to not snap in place. Loved this faucet, but it started leaking internally after a few years :(
When new, this faucet was great. I bought in December 2013. As of October 2017, it leaks in two places. It drips out the aerator, so I assume it needs a new cartridge already. Worse, it leaks internally & drips down the plastic supply hoses, where it has started to damage the cabinet. (See attached picture.) I will try to replace the cartridge and see if it solves both problems, but this is a huge design defect if a bad cartridge causes an internal housing leak. Search for the key word "leak" in the reviews, and you will see others have experienced this same internal-leak problem. I recommend finding an alternate faucet, perhaps one with metal supply hoses. Very high quality, a small trick required to avoid loose handle
Good high-quality faucet. We are picky people and are happy with this. Only small gripe is the handle becomes loose because of a screw-type mechanism that screws right into a hard metal knob. Because these are two hard metals with a coarse screw thread it tends to come loose over time.To fix loose handle pull off logo near handle, unscrew, pop off cap, add something semi-hard between the end of the screw and the metal knob it presses into. I suggest a small piece of hard rubber or something. Then put it back together. It's hard to explain but obvious when you see it.

Great faucet... Edit: Except that max hot water position still mixing cold water.
Quality faucet. Looks nice. Smooth. Solid. No leaks. Easy installEdit: I've discovered a problem with the valve. I wasn't able to get high temperature hot water that I had available in my other sinks. I thought it was just my water temperature, but realized the valve wasn't able to stop cold mixing completely when turned to the maximum hot position. In order to get soley hot water (high temperature) I have to crank down the handle a couple times back and forth pushing down with some pressure. This is not something I want to do or should need to do; it will likely lead to damage of the valve/handle. Will see what Delta has to say...
